
Crafting a Franchise Sales Funnel: Understanding the Journey
Creating a successful franchise sales funnel is foundational for attracting serious buyers and driving conversions. Understanding the stages of your potential franchisee's decision-making process is essential. Typically, this journey can be broken down into three distinct phases: Awareness, Consideration, and Decision. Each stage contains unique questions and challenges that necessitate tailored communication strategies.
Effective Lead Capture Strategies for Franchisors
Your lead capture mechanism forms the vital first interaction with prospective franchisees. A responsive landing page is essential for making a strong first impression. Your lead capture form should be visually appealing, straightforward, and focused on delivering value.
When designing your lead capture page, consider the following elements:
- Clear Headline: Communicate the core benefits of your franchise upfront.
- Value Proposition: A concise description of what potential buyers will receive (e.g., brochures, videos).
- Simple Form: Collect only essential information such as name, email, and phone number.
- Strong CTA: Use a compelling call to action that directs users on the next steps.
Additionally, consider using lead magnets like free guides or exclusive reports that entice prospects to submit their contact information.
Qualifying Leads Gently: A Strategic Approach
While it is tempting to cast a wide net in hopes of generating many leads, the true objective is to attract qualified prospects. Striking the right balance between obtaining necessary information and maintaining engagement can be challenging. Implement a gentle lead qualification strategy:
- Pose 1-2 introductory screening questions that won't overwhelm potential leads.
- Provide a follow-up questionnaire to delve deeper after initial interactions.
- Ensure easy access to speak with a representative whenever prospects show readiness to engage.
This approach allows for a nurturing process while weeding out unqualified leads.
Stay Engaged Through Automated Follow-Ups
Once a lead enters your franchise sales funnel, the next vital phase is consistent engagement. Many franchise investors take time to consider their options, so it is crucial to remain at the forefront of their minds with timely, value-driven communication. Implementing an email automation strategy can facilitate this process:
- Develop a series of follow-up emails that span two to four weeks.
- Share valuable content such as introductory videos, answers to frequently asked questions, or success stories from existing franchisees.
- Include actions like prompts to schedule discovery calls or attend virtual webinars.
Building rapport with leads during this period is critical to fostering trust and nurturing future franchise owners.
Empowering Your Sales Team: Collaboration Matters
Your sales team plays an indispensable role in converting leads at the final stages of the sales process. Regular training and clear communication channels should be prioritized. A structured approach equipped with well-defined protocols ensures that your sales representatives know the best practices for reaching out to leads. They should know:
- What key selling points to communicate at each stage of the funnel.
- The timing of follow-ups to capitalize on lead interest.
- How to tailor their communication to reflect the buyer’s existing knowledge and concerns.
By focusing on these areas, you can ensure that leads feel valued and supported throughout their decision-making journey.
Tracking Success: The Importance of Metrics
A powerful sales funnel is not just about attracting leads; it’s about tracking performance metrics to improve your strategy continually. Key performance indicators (KPIs) such as conversion rates, lead response times, and customer retention rates should be monitored regularly. Consider employing technology like Customer Relationship Management (CRM) systems to streamline tracking.
Data-driven insights derived from these metrics can guide adjustments to your funnel processes, ensuring optimal efficiency and deeper connections with leads.
